from flask import Flask, jsonify, render_template import json import os import threading import time import monitor # our monitor.py — reused directly, not run as a separate process app = Flask(__name__) DATA_FILE = "monitor-data.json" def background_monitor_loop(): """Runs monitor.monitor() every CHECK_INTERVAL seconds inside this same process/container, since the Dockerfile only starts one process (gunicorn running app.py). This replaces running monitor.py as a separate process, which never actually happened after deployment (only app.py ran, monitor.py was never invoked).""" print("Starting background monitor thread...") while True: try: monitor.monitor() except Exception as e: print("Monitor thread error:", e) time.sleep(monitor.CHECK_INTERVAL) # Start the background thread once, when this module is imported by # gunicorn. Safe because the Dockerfile runs a single gunicorn worker # (no --workers flag => defaults to 1), so this thread won't be # duplicated across multiple worker processes. monitor_thread = threading.Thread(target=background_monitor_loop, daemon=True) monitor_thread.start() @app.route("/") def home(): return render_template("dashboard.html") @app.route("/dashboard") def dashboard(): return render_template("dashboard.html") @app.route("/api/metrics") def metrics(): if not os.path.exists(DATA_FILE): return jsonify([]) with open(DATA_FILE, "r") as f: data = json.load(f) return jsonify(data) @app.route("/health") def health(): return { "status": "healthy" } if __name__ == "__main__": app.run(host="0.0.0.0", port=5000, debug=True)
